Обсуждение: Postgres 9.2.2 Bug in Select with Left Join

Поиск
Список
Период
Сортировка

Postgres 9.2.2 Bug in Select with Left Join

От
"liebehenz"
Дата:

Hello,

 

i have here a strange bug.

a_name (char var 48)  is sometimes empty  in the select of the new 9.2.2 Version,

the a_name is in the table column set.

Something is going wrong.

 

 

here in screenshot same identical database on  9.2.1 Server and 9.2.2 Server

that’s not good.

 

 

 

Вложения

Re: Postgres 9.2.2 Bug in Select with Left Join

От
Tom Lane
Дата:
"liebehenz" <liebehenz@mts-software.com> writes:
> i have here a strange bug.

Can't really say anything about this without a self-contained test case
(which your screenshot isn't, even if it were 100% readable).

However, are you sure that it's 9.2.2 and not 9.2.1 that's wrong?
There were several planner bugs fixed in between.

            regards, tom lane

Re: Postgres 9.2.2 Bug in Select with Left Join

От
"Kevin Grittner"
Дата:
liebehenz wrote:

> a_name (char var 48) is sometimes empty in the select of the new 9.2.2
> Version,
>
> the a_name is in the table column set.
>
> Something is going wrong.

> here in screenshot same identical database on 9.2.1 Server and 9.2.2 Server

Character-based results are preferred on a list like this. A psql
session is good. A self-contained test case (which take things from
creation and population of test data through to the misbehavior is
ideal).

For starters can you show us (copy/paste) the results of running
this in psql?:

\d artikel
select a_id, char_length(a_name), a_name
  from artikel
  where a_id in (323, 324);

-Kevin